Procedure
Step 1 On the home screen of the UPS LCD, choose System Info > Maintenance >
Battery Maint.
Step 2 Tap Start next to Capacity Test to start a capacity test.
Figure 5-12 Starting a capacity test
----End

The capacity test automatically stops in any of the following cases:
● The minimum cell voltage reaches 2.65 V.
● The load fluctuation exceeds 10%.
● An alarm is generated.
The test is complete when the minimum cell voltage reaches 2.65 V. A maximum of recent
36 capacity test records can be saved.
